Значения по умолчанию свойств класса домена GORM - PullRequest
15 голосов
/ 24 ноября 2011

Может быть, глупый вопрос, но где / как мне определить значения по умолчанию для свойств класса домена GORM? Например, когда я создаю новый экземпляр объекта Company, я хочу, чтобы значением по умолчанию для страны свойства было «США». Я думаю, я мог бы сделать это в создании контроллера, но это выглядит немного грязно. Что-то вроде:

def create = { def companyInstance = new Company() companyInstance.properties = params companyInstance.accepted = "USA" ...

1 Ответ

28 голосов
/ 24 ноября 2011

Поместите его в сам класс домена

class Company {
    String country = "USA"
}
...